Electrical contractor activity in Marion County, FL

Ranked by the number of available electrical permit records associated with each business in Marion County, FL since March 2026. This is public-record activity, not an editorial or pay-to-play ranking.

Rank Contractor Published record count Record context
#1 Christian Kobilas 137 records Published history
#2 SECO Energy 78 records Published history
#3 SECOEnergy 44 records Published history
#4 FRANK GAY SERVICES 40 records Published history
#5 HAMMOND ELECTRIC LLC 14 records Published history
#6 ANDREW ELECTRIC CO. INC DBA ANDREW DESIGN & ELECTR 12 records Published history
#7 JAMIE "THE ELECTRICIAN" LLC 10 records Published history
#8 TROPICAL ELECTRIC AND LIGHTING, INC 10 records Published history
#9 MISTER SPARKY 9 records Published history
#10 POWER PLAY ELECTRIC, LLC 8 records Published history
#11 MR. ELECTRIC DBA OF DALE R YOX INC 8 records Published history
#12 MIDSTATE ELECTRIC OF OCALA, LLC 8 records Published history
#13 GALLAGHER ELECTRIC COMPANY OF OCALA LLC 7 records Published history
#14 ROAM ELECTRIC, INC 7 records Published history
#15 FAMILY CHOICE ELECTRICAL REPAIR, INC 7 records Published history
#16 CIRACO ELECTRIC LLC 7 records Published history
#17 CHUCK'S STOKES ELECTRIC OF CENTRAL FL INC 7 records Published history
#18 CRAFT ELECTRIC INC. 7 records Published history
#19 All American Air & Electric 6 records Published history
#20 IN CHARGE ELECTRIC INC 6 records Published history

Frequently asked

How is this record list calculated?
We count available source-published electrical records in Marion County, FL over the displayed date window, group them by the published business name, and sort descending. There is no editorial weighting or paid placement. It is not an exhaustive contractor directory.
Where does the permit data come from?
The linked market page identifies the publishing jurisdiction, newest displayed record date, and available fields. Source dates and field coverage vary by jurisdiction; review the Marion County, FL source details before relying on a time-sensitive workflow.
How is this different from a review directory?
This page summarizes available public-record history for a selected city and trade. Review directories summarize user experiences. Neither one establishes current availability, workmanship, or a recommendation; use the source fields and your own diligence for the decision at hand.
Why is contractor X not on this list?
The available records may not contain that exact name, the source may omit names, or a different applicant or licensee name may appear. This is not a conclusion about a business's current work. The full source-bound search interface is on the Marion County, FL record page.
